La Confusion dans un jeu de Commande.
Ici, je veux comprendre cette commande.
aplay -D hw:0,0 /opt/WL1271_demo_01/gallery/Pop.wav
Pourquoi nous avons utilisé asound.conf
fichier.
nous avons besoin de mettre à jour l'adresse bluetooth du kit mains libres dans ce fichier pour lire des fichiers audio au dispositif mains libres?
Quelqu'un peut-il m'Expliquer aplay
de commande et comment sa fonctionne?
pourquoi nous avons utilisé ici -D hw:0,0
dans cette?
pourquoi nous avons pas utilisé ici -Dplug:bluetooth hw:0,0
?
==================================================================
Voici mon /etc/asound.fichier conf
pcm.!bluetooth {
type bluetooth
device 00:23:78:41:AB:9F
playback_ports {
0 alsa_pcm:playback_1
1 alsa_pcm:playback_2
}
capture_ports {
0 alsa_pcm:capture_1
1 alsa_pcm:capture_2
}
}
pcm.!default {
type plug
slave.pcm bluetooth
}
pcm.jack {
type jack
playback_ports {
0 alsa_pcm:playback_1
1 alsa_pcm:playback_2
}
capture_ports {
0 alsa_pcm:capture_1
1 alsa_pcm:capture_2
}
}
Vous devez vous connecter pour publier un commentaire.
Vous pointez
aplay
directement à un morceau de matériel (hw:0,1
– deuxième sortie du premier dispositif sonore) au lieu de le laisser utiliser votreasound.conf
définition. Essayez plutôt ceci:Veuillez noter que si vous utilisez l'interface ALSA cette façon rien d'autre à l'aide de cet appareil (par exemple, le Pulse Audio démon) que ce ne soit pas le travail. Vous pourriez probablement utiliser Pulse Audio au lieu de "brutes" ALSA, mais je ne peux pas vous aider.
Mise à jour:
Comment pouvons-nous savoir? Vous avez fourni la commande. Cela signifie: utiliser directement (ce qui signifie: le fait d'ignorer les alias dans
asound.conf
fichier) la première sortie de la première de matériel audio (ce qui signifie généralement la sortie de votre première carte son).Parce que le '-D' option accepte un seul paramètre. Cela peut être "hw:0,0', cela peut être " plug:bluetooth, cela peut être n'importe quel alias définis dans le
asound.conf
de fichier ("jack" ou "bluetooth" défini dans votre fichier), mais il doit être un paramètre. "plug:bluetooth hw:0,0" serait deux paramètres.asound.conf
et d'omettre le "- quelque chose D' option tous les toghetherhttp://www.alsa-project.org/main/index.php/Asoundrc#The_naming_of_PCM_devices
Semble que vous avez un problème avec votre pulse audio setup. Ici est un manuel ubuntu pour résoudre les configurations bluetooth, y compris un jeu. Ici est le manuel de configuration bluetooth pour ubuntu.
De votre configuration, je vois qu'il vous manque le nom de l'appareil, à savoir "aplay -D par défaut hw:0,1 -c-2 -f S16_LE abc.wav &". Pour mon casque, j'ai utilisé un exemple ici, et cela fonctionne pour moi jusqu'à présent.